Job Description The Quantitative Strategist is a front-office quantitative professional responsible for supporting the design, development, and implementation of pricing, risk, and analytics models with a focus on commodity derivatives businesses. As part of the Global Capital Markets strategic buildout initiative, the role will join a newly established FICC analytics team focused on delivering high-quality analytical support to trading and sales partners across business lines. The position will work as a desk-aligned quantitative partner in daily trading and risk management activities, while collaborating closely with Risk Oversight, Technology, and Model Governance teams to help integrate proprietary models into a holistic, real-time securities risk platform. Strong communication skills and the ability to operate effectively in a collaborative, regulated environment are essential. 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S: Support research on commodities markets and develop practical understanding of no-arbitrage pricing and rates modeling techniques under the guidance of senior team leadership. Develop quantitative models and simulate trading strategies for commodity derivatives products. Develop futures and forward price curve methodologies for commodity derivatives across crude oil, natural gas, metals, and electricity power markets. Develop pricing models for commodity Asian options, basket options, electricity power forward agreements, precious metals products, and metal leasing agreements. Value exchange-traded futures and options products and support associated pricing and risk analytics. Participate in the development of the Fixed Income Analytics Platform and support the integration of quantitative models into risk systems. Collaborate with Model Validation and Risk Oversight teams throughout model approval and post-approval monitoring processes, and support activities required for regulatory examinations. Partner with Technology teams in the integration, testing, and implementation of proprietary pricing and risk models. Basic Requirements: Ph.D. in Mathematics, Physics, Engineering, or a related quantitative discipline. Strong knowledge of mathematical finance, stochastic calculus, neural-network modeling, and machine learning methodologies. One to three years of experience as a front-office quantitative strategist at a major financial institution. Preferred Requirements: Strong programming skills in C++ and Python. Demonstrated ability to work effectively with trading, risk, technology, and governance partners in support of front-office quantitative modeling and analytics objectives. Strong written and verbal communication skills are required.
